Necklace
2003-22-3
From: New Guinea | New Guinea Highlands
Curatorial Section: Oceanian
Native Name | Kina |
Object Number | 2003-22-3 |
Current Location | Collections Storage |
Provenience | New Guinea | New Guinea Highlands |
Section | Oceanian |
Materials | Shell | Silk | Pigment |
Description | Crescent shaped necklace (kina) of gold-lip mother-of-pearl shell. Holes drilled at the two points, into which a white silk cord is knotted and stitiched. On one knot, traces of red pigment, possibly indicating festival wear. Small shallow hole, probably natural, about four cm. from one tip. |
Height | 7.5 cm |
Width | 18 cm |
Credit Line | Gift of Leonard and Helen Evelev, 2003 |
